The role

You'll be the front line for recruiters on the platform — the person they reach when they're getting started, hit a wall, or need something resolved fast. Day to day that means recruiter onboarding, platform and process help, submission and approval issues, payout questions, and disputes. You'll work in the platform Support chat, Slack, and email, and partner closely with the teams around you: Sourcing/onboarding, Activations, and Account Managers.

This is an early, high-ownership seat. Support at Paraform is still largely manual today, so a big part of the job is not just answering questions but designing the recurring ones out of existence — better onboarding, better self-serve, better systems. The work sits close enough to the rest of the business that you'll be expected to reason about the marketplace, not just clear a queue.

What you'll do
  • Be the first, fastest, and friendliest point of contact for recruiters across chat, Slack, and email.

  • Triage and prioritize a high volume of competing requests — knowing what to answer first and why.

  • Resolve platform, submission, approval, and payout issues, escalating cleanly when you can't.

  • Help newly approved recruiters get to their first submissions and understand where they're competitive.

  • Spot patterns across incoming questions and build structural fixes — onboarding improvements, Help Center content, self-serve flows — that reduce repeat volume.

  • Partner with Sourcing, Activations, and Account Managers to keep recruiters engaged and active.

What we're looking for

The traits below map to how we evaluate throughout the process:

  • Recruiter-first mindset — you instinctively reason from the customer's incentives and experience, and you protect their trust, especially around money and fairness.

  • Sharp communication — clear, warm, professional writing with a casual-but-polished tone and no careless slips.

  • Prioritization & judgment — you triage ambiguity with a defensible rationale and name what you don't know instead of guessing.

  • Business & systems thinking — you connect a support pattern to the underlying business dynamics and think in systems and unit economics, not one-off tickets.

  • Ownership & bias to build — you want to design problems away and drive self-serve; you learn fast and are comfortable building in a role that's still manual today.

Nice to have
  • Experience in a high-volume, customer- or recruiter-facing role (support, ops, recruiting, account management).

  • Exposure to marketplaces, recruiting, or ATS tools (e.g. Ashby, Greenhouse).

  • Experience with payment processing and/or fintech.

  • A track record of improving a process, not just staffing one.

About Paraform:

Paraform is a marketplace modernizing one of the largest and most fragmented markets in the world: hiring. We partner with industry leaders like Decagon, Palantir, Rippling, Abridge, and Hightouch to hire world-class talent, and are growing quickly - 8×-ing revenue last year.

Paraform is the first end-to-end AI recruiting marketplace that connects companies with thousands of specialized recruiters and AI agents that work together to fill roles faster and more accurately.

Our mission is to make hiring fast, reliable, and scalable for every company in the world.

At Paraform, we believe recruiting works best when the right people are working on the right problems, combining human judgment with AI that truly understands hiring. That’s why we’re building a new foundation for how companies hire, bringing together specialized recruiters and modern AI tools.

We treat recruiters like entrepreneurs, not vendors – and we’re building the financial, operational, and technical infrastructure that powers their success.

We are backed by the best investors and technology leaders: Scale, Felicis, A*, BOND, Liquid 2, DST Global, the founders of YouTube, Instacart, Canva, and more.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
